Mr Ash Sharma
Ophthalmology
About
In his practice at Birmingham and Midland Eye Centre, Mr Sharma tailors cataract surgery to meet each patient’s unique needs, offering advanced techniques such as extended range of focus lens implants. He regularly performs urgent retinal detachment surgery and provides treatments for macular degeneration, diabetic eye disease, and complex lens implant issues. His approach blends precision surgery with a focus on patient-centred care.
Mr Sharma is also recognised as an expert witness in medico-legal work, reflecting his deep knowledge and commitment to ophthalmology. He is a member of several professional organisations, including the Royal College of Ophthalmologists and the British and Eire Association of Vitreo-Retinal Surgeons. Beyond clinical practice, he contributes to the field through teaching and advancing surgical techniques.
